4***@qq.com
4***@qq.com
  • 发布:2017-08-03 11:32
  • 更新:2018-01-12 13:59
  • 阅读:6446

mui 扫描二维码功能扫描返回结果后怎么关闭barcode 窗口

分类:MUI
mui

try{

         //自定义的扫描控件样式    
         var styles = {frameColor: "#29E52C",scanbarColor: "#29E52C",background: ""}    
        //扫描控件构造    
        scan = new plus.barcode.Barcode('bcid','EAN13: ',styles);    
        scan.onmarked = onmarked;     
        scan.onerror = onerror;    
        scan.start();    

      }catch(e){    
        alert("出现错误啦:\n"+e);    
         }    
      };    

function onerror(e){
alert(e);
};
function onmarked( type, result ) {
alert(result);
//得到结果
};

2017-08-03 11:32 负责人:无 分享
已邀请:
5***@qq.com

5***@qq.com

结束条码识别:scan.cancel();

关闭条码识别控件:scan.close();

4***@qq.com

4***@qq.com (作者)

感谢啊,我被这个破文档坑了,没有这个方法.

5***@qq.com

5***@qq.com

有是有的,你再往下翻一点点就能看到了。
坑是挺多的,踩过一遍就好了。

浩哥哥323

浩哥哥323

为什么我关闭之后再进来,在安卓手机上回闪退啊?求大神告知 原因

  • 4***@qq.com (作者)

    之前做的时候会因为页面切换动画的问题闪退.

    2018-01-12 14:06

  • 1***@qq.com

    因为你没有释放那个组件

    2018-01-12 14:23

该问题目前已经被锁定, 无法添加新回复